There are many data recovery firms that will recover data from a DVD for you. There are also instructional videos on youtube showing how to recover data from damaged discs.
Most memory manufacturers, like SanDisk also have software tools that will help you to recover damaged data... You should check your memory manufacturer's website for similar tools.

Not always. Depending on the type of damage you should be able to recover data. Unfortunately, you will not be able to recover data if you have wiped or rubbed the motherboard with a magnet, or if you have submerged it in water for an extended period in time.
